> > Cygwin is a UNIX environment, developed by Red Hat, for Windows. It
> > consists of two parts:
> > A DLL (cygwin1.dll) which acts as a UNIX emulation layer providing
> > substantial UNIX API functionality.
> > A collection of tools, ported from UNIX, which provide UNIX/Linux look
> > and feel.
